MSH2 rearrangements are involved in approximately 10% of hereditary non,polyposis colorectal cancer (HNPCC) families, and in most of the rearrangements, exon I is deleted. We scanned by quantitative multiplex polymerase chain reaction (PCR) of short fluorescent fragments (QMPSF) 200 kb of genomic sequences upstream of the MSH2 transcription initiation site in 21 HNPCC families with exon I deletion
